M

I'm really impressed with Deepbrain. The website d...

I'm really impressed with Deepbrain. The website deepbrain.net is well-designed and user-friendly. The customer support team is quick to respond and provides helpful solutions. I would definitely recommend them to others!

Comments:

No comments